12g carbon combines with 64 g sulphur to form CS2. 12 g carbon also combines with 32 g oxygen to form CO2. 10 g sulphur combines with 10 g oxygen to form SO2. These data illustrate the:

a
Law of multiple proportions
b
Law of definite proportions
c
Law of reciprocal proportions
d
Law of gaseous volumes.
answer is C.

Detailed Solution
Ratio of the weights of S and O combining with fixed weight of C is 64 : 32 = 2 : 1. Ratio of the weights of S and O combining directly = 10 : 10 = I : 1. The two ratios are simple multiple of each other. This proves law of reciprocal proportions.
